Athlete’s foot, medically known as tinea pedis, is a common fungal infection that affects the skin of the feet. It can cause a variety of symptoms, including itching, burning, and scaling.
Curing athlete’s foot at home fast involves using various over-the-counter and natural remedies to alleviate symptoms and eliminate the underlying infection. This can include applying topical antifungal creams or sprays, soaking the feet in Epsom salt or apple cider vinegar solutions, or using tea tree oil.
There are several benefits to curing athlete’s foot at home fast, including preventing the infection from spreading to other parts of the body or to other people, reducing the risk of complications such as cellulitis or lymphangitis, and improving overall foot health and comfort.
How to Stop Tooth Pain Fast at HomeTooth pain can be excruciating, but there are a few things you can do at home to relieve the pain until you can see a dentist.
One of the most effective ways to stop tooth pain fast at home is to rinse your mouth with warm salt water. The salt helps to reduce inflammation and pain. You can also try applying a cold compress to your face to help numb the pain.
Another option is to take over-the-counter pain medication, such as ibuprofen or acetaminophen. These medications can help to reduce inflammation and pain. However, it is important to follow the directions on the package carefully and to avoid taking too much medication.
